WebOct 10, 2006 · Glycation is a common post-translational modification of proteins, resulting from the chemical reaction between reducing sugars such as glucose and the primary amino groups on protein [ 1 ]. This non-enzymatic glycosylation reaction generates structural heterogeneity in recombinant IgG 1 antibodies produced by cell culture processes [ 2 ]. WebProtein glycation is a non-enzymatic glycosylation that can occur to proteins in the human body, and it is implicated in the pathogenesis of multiple chronic diseases. Glycation can also occur to recombinant antibodies during cell culture, which generates structural heterogeneity in the product.
